Los Angeles Rams defensive tackle Aaron Donald has been granted a restraining order against a woman he alleges has been stalking him and falsely believes they are married. According to court documents, Donald claims the woman has repeatedly contacted him and his family, causing him significant distress and concern for his safety.
The restraining order prohibits the woman from contacting Donald, his wife, or approaching their home, workplace, or any events they attend. Violating the order could lead to legal consequences. This situation highlights the difficulties celebrities and professional athletes often face in maintaining their privacy and security in the face of unwanted attention and potential harassment. The court's decision to grant the restraining order suggests the judge found sufficient evidence to support Donald's claims and protect him and his family from further unwanted contact.
